ت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
برنامج إدارة قواعد بيانات SQLite
#7
(20-02-19, 12:17 PM)العيد1403 كتب : أن النوع text يعتبر حقل نصي أما Stringe يعتبر حرفي بطول 255 على الأكثر كما أن النوع Text لايظهر على datagride وهذا مجرب

لقد حاولت أن أكتب النوعين Date و Stringe يدويا ولكني لم ينجح معي الأمر ممكن شرح الطريقة التي كتبت بها

وبالتوفيق

لا أعلم بصراحة ان datagride  لا يقراء ال text     هل هذا في لازاروس ؟

بالنسبة لل vb.net  فهو يعمل عادي جدا

المهم بالنسبة لقاعدة البيانات  وكتابة الحقول

في المرفقات مثالين
قاعدة تم إنشائها بواسطة برنامج   SQLiteMaestro
وبها انواع حقول مختلفة
وهذة جملة ال sql الخاصة بإنشاء الجدول في البرنامج
كود :
--Table: Table01

--DROP TABLE Table01;

CREATE TABLE Table01 (
 ID              integer NOT NULL PRIMARY KEY AUTOINCREMENT,
 Field_char      char(50),
 Field_nvarchar  nvarchar(500),
 Field_text      text,
 Field_date      date,
 Field_datetime  datetime,
 Field_boolean   boolean
);




وقاعدة تم انشائها بواسطة برنامج DB Browser for SQLite
وبها نفس انواع الحقول التي بالقاعدة السابقة
وهذة جملة ال sql الخاصة بإنشاء الجدول في البرنامج
كود :
CREATE TABLE "Table01" (
    "ID"    INTEGER NOT NULL PRIMARY KEY AUTOINCREMENT,
    "Field_char"    char(50),
    "Field_nvarchar"    nvarchar(500),
    "Field_text"    TEXT,
    "Field_date"    date,
    "Field_datetime"    datetime,
    "Field_boolean"    boolean
);


هل تلاحظ أي فرق بين الجملتين ؟؟

الفكرة لقد قرات نوع الحق في البرنامج الاول وقمت بنسخة ولصقه في نوع الحقل للبرنامج الثاني

قمت بالتجربة لعملية الحفظ وعرض datagridview على vb.net  
النتيجة لا فرق بين القاعدتين  


فإعتذر إن كنت مخطأ أو قد فهمت كلامك خطأ
فلازلت مبتدئ في البرمجة في vb.net 
وتحت المبتدئ في لازاروس

ولكنى أحاول الأجتهاد 

تمنياتي لك بالتوفيق والنجاح


الملفات المرفقة
.zip   TestDB by sqlite maestro.zip (الحجم : 863 بايت / التحميلات : 27)
.zip   testdb by DB Browser.zip (الحجم : 719 بايت / التحميلات : 24)
لا إله إلا الله وحده لا شريك له له الملك وله الحمد وهو على كل شئ قدير
سبحان الله وبحمده سبحان الله العظيم
سبحان الله والحمد لله ولا إله إلا الله والله أكبر ولا حول ولا قوة إلا بالله العلى العظيم
رب أغفر لي 

الرد }}}
تم الشكر بواسطة: awidan76 , asemshahen5


الردود في هذا الموضوع
RE: برنامج إدارة قواعد بيانات SQLite - بواسطة princelovelorn - 20-02-19, 07:20 PM

الم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  [مشروع] برنامج إدارة الديون - بحلته الجديدة أبوبكر سويدان 26 17,559 19-02-25, 12:48 PM
آخر رد: almohtrefnez
  صدور النسخة 3.0 من برنامج لازاروس vbtemp 0 660 31-12-23, 01:44 PM
آخر رد: vbtemp
Wink طلب برنامج Mareo 0 2,313 19-04-22, 06:56 AM
آخر رد: Mareo
  [كود] برنامج إدارة الديون - مفتوح المصدر أبوبكر سويدان 6 7,969 15-12-20, 12:02 AM
آخر رد: أبوبكر سويدان
  المساعدة في تجربة وتقييم برنامج مبيعات أبوبكر سويدان 22 11,862 09-07-20, 05:16 PM
آخر رد: أبوبكر سويدان
  برنامج لاستخراج الرقم التسلسلي للسواقة C أبوبكر سويدان 2 3,304 09-07-20, 05:14 PM
آخر رد: أبوبكر سويدان
  برنامج لفحص الاتصال بشبكة الإنترنت أبوبكر سويدان 1 2,662 07-07-20, 12:37 PM
آخر رد: العيد1403
  قواعد بيانات MariaDB أبوبكر سويدان 5 4,272 22-06-20, 04:20 PM
آخر رد: أبوبكر سويدان
  برنامج - استخلاص اليوم والشهر والسنة من تاريخ محدد أبوبكر سويدان 3 4,801 01-10-19, 01:09 PM
آخر رد: husseinwageih
  برنامج المبدع لإدارة المصروفات والإيرادات Adrees 6 5,884 28-06-19, 08:04 PM
آخر رد: abu ammar

التنقل السريع :


يقوم بقرائة الموضوع: